Transaction 508e96a73541e23546613bf0132165e2bb7edabbea6a68ed5e5c92a32ad5e613
1 Input
1 Output
-
508e96a73541e23546613bf0132165e2bb7edabbea6a68ed5e5c92a32ad5e613:0
- value
- 3995028
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26f474038f85da8f8ba760b622cb4353bf677705 OP_EQUAL
- address
- 35EzSjkoSqipPAzxkiFBZHfMz6GfBWtxuc